What problem does it solve?

This Skill helps governance and tooling by identifying valid Skill units (directories with a root SKILL.md that includes a name and description) and preparing standardized metadata for each unit.

Core Features & Use Cases

  • Validates Skill units against the official definition (root SKILL.md with YAML frontmatter, name and description present)
  • Extracts and aggregates metadata: dependencies, components, and toxicity signals for each valid unit
  • Produces a machine-friendly YAML document per Skill unit for cataloging and discovery
